交互式Rollup方案,比如我们的ArbitrumRollup,通过让某个验证者断言执行结果、而其他验证者可以挑战断言的方式,来加速智能合约的执行。如果挑战期过去,而没有任何人提出挑战,则该断言就被认为是真的,然后系统就推进。一般情况下,断言都会是对的,挑战也是很少出现的,所以一条Rollup侧链就能比链上合约更快推进、开销也更低。
但,挑战期应该设成多长呢?在本文中,我将指出,有些因素会使我们希望有更长的挑战时间,某些因素正好相反。我会推导出一个旨在最小化侧链整体运行成本的最优挑战期公式。
长挑战期的好处
观点:美联储的流动性减少将对高风险资产产生巨大冲击:1月10日消息,对于那些担心长达十年之久超宽松货币政策已在全球造成资产泡沫的人来说,麻烦的最初迹象可能正在价格高涨的市场中孕育发展。Michael Hartnett等美国银行策略师认为,在包括加密货币、钯金、长持续期科技股和其他历史性风险市场领域在内的资产中,泡沫正在同时爆裂。
Infrastructure Capital Advisors投资组合经理Jay Hatfield称,来自美联储的流动性减少,将导致股票风险溢价和利率上升,这将继续对市场上风险最高的资产产生不成比例的冲击,包括对亏损科技股,网红股,特别是无内在价值加密货币的动能驱动投资。(金十)[2022/1/10 8:37:56]
众所周知,更长的挑战时间就是更安全,因为审查攻击的难度会变得更高。恶意行动者可能会尝试报一个虚假断言,然后审查尝试挑战断言的交易,直到挑战期过去。但是,挑战期越长,这样的攻击就越不可能成功。
观点:加密货币交易量达16万亿美元,已超越FAANG年交易量:8月11日消,据Ark Investment Management 分析师 Yassine Elmandjra在推特上表示,加密货币交易已经超越FAANG年交易量。FAANG是指Facebook、苹果(Apple)、亚马逊(Amazon)、Netflix 和谷歌(Google),这五大科技巨头在公开股票市场的年交易量约为12万亿美元,而加密货币在 2020 年和 2021 年产生了超过 16 万亿美元的交易量。2021年,加密市场交易量呈现爆发式增长,以Coinbase最近发布的二季度报告显示,当季该公司交易量达到4600亿美元。[2021/8/11 1:49:00]
一种看起来可行的模型是定义挑战期时长为C,而审查攻击成功率随C的增长而呈指数级下降。如果整个Rollup侧链的价值是V,那么攻击者能盗取的价值预计为V·e^(-AC),A为常数。
观点:灰度今年第四季度已增持115236枚BTC,比特币流动性危机将至:CoinCorner首席执行官Danny Scott发推表示,灰度今年第四季度已经增持了115236枚BTC,相当于22亿美元。他再次重申:BTC流动性危机即将到来。
此前12月2日,Danny Scott曾发推表示,加密交易所中存储的比特币数量正在以前所未有的速度减少。用户正在积极构建比特币长期头寸。比特币流动性危机即将到来。(U.Today)[2020/12/16 15:24:30]
那么,为了阻止这样的攻击,我们就需要断言者先存储,比如10V·e^(-AC),的价值,如果攻击失败,攻击者要付出的代价会远大于其攻击预期收益。
观点:企业采用智能合约和区块链技术的速度将加快:Chainlink首席执行官Sergey Nazarov和Interwork Alliance主席Ron Resnick表示,企业采用智能合约和区块链技术的速度很快就会达到峰值。(Cointelegraph)[2020/7/9]
但这样就为诚实的断言者施加了同样的成本,他们也必须锁定同样规模的资金。如果协议设计良好而且底层链也活跃,那么一般来说恰好会有一位诚实断言者存储了这么多保证金。那么,单位时间内的成本就是保证金规模乘以一个名义利率。
挑战期越长,保证金规模就可以越小,所以——更长的存款时间可以降低侧链的运营总成本。
短挑战期的好处
要从侧链中取钱的人当然喜欢更短的挑战期,因为用户取款之后要等一个挑战期走完,钱才算真正回到了底层链上。从用户的角度来看,在挑战期中,他们的钱是完全被锁定的。
我们可以这样建模:假设在一个平均区块时间内,有比例为W的资金要退出。那么,在任一时间点,锁定的取款数量就是CWV,因此侧链用户的成本就是这个数值乘以一个利率。
因为这个成本也跟C成比例,因此更短的挑战期能够降低运营成本。
找出最优挑战时长
最优的挑战市场会是某种折中,即两项成本的总和是最小化的。有趣的是,两个方面的成本都是由资金锁定带来的,就是锁定的资金数量乘以假设的利率。因此,挑战期最优时长就跟利率无关了——只需最小化锁定资金的总数量即可。
从等式来看,任一时间点,锁定的资金总量是:
10V*e^(-AC)+CWV
因为V在两项中都有,所以它不会影响最小值点。最小值点会出现在10×e^(-AC)+CW最小的时候。只需对C求导,令倒数值为0,就可以解出最小值点处的C。
结果就是C=ln/A。
这个值对实践有什么意义?我们可代入一些还算可靠的数字,如上图所示。我们假设A使得攻击者在一个区块的时间内持续审查成功的成功率高达99%,即A=-ln(0.99)=0.01。再假设每天都有1%的资金要取出,那么按15秒的区块时间算,每个区块的取款比例约为W=0.000002。把这些假设代入公式,可得最优挑战期为C=1081个区块,约为4.5小时
那么成本到底有多高?在任一时间点,都有约等于侧链全部资产价值的0.2%以不同方式锁定。如果名义利率是5%,那么结果就是:总的锁定成本约为每年对侧链的总价值征收0.01%的税收。只需付出这么低的代价,你就能得到一条更快、Gas消耗量更小,更可扩展的侧链。
原文链接:https://medium.com/offchainlabs/optimizing-challenge-periods-in-rollup-b61378c87277作者:EdFelten翻译:阿剑
标签:加密货币ROLLROL比特币加密货币市场总市值数量级是多少roll币能出坐骑吗Roller Inu比特币市值跌破5000亿美元
本文来源:彩云区块链作者:ack123888自第三次比特币区块奖励减半以来已过去十多天了。现在的数据显示,自5月3日创下140EH/s的历史新高以来,以比特币为代表的SHA256算法币种算力损失.
1900/1/1 0:00:00“跨链之王”,“Web3.0开启者“,创造过以太坊的男人新作”,“链上治理创新者”……波卡,这个号称以太坊最具实力的竞争项目近期公布了上线的具体流程,今天,我们一起来了解一下,关于波卡.
1900/1/1 0:00:00密码经济密码经济是基于非对称密码和分布式共识机制建立的更加安全、高效、自由的数字经济。直接解决互联网经济面临的信息安全和信息垄断问题.
1900/1/1 0:00:00自从3.12暴跌后,泰达在以太坊上的ERC20USDT增发即呈现高频大额特点,激起行业热议,那么站在5月比特币价格“触万”时刻回望,处于比特币价格暴跌后的恢复和加速上涨间的4月.
1900/1/1 0:00:002019年底爆发的新冠肺炎疫情,对我国经济社会发展带来极大冲击。无论是作为“毛细血管”的中小微民营企业,还是作为我国经济发展“压舱石”的大中型企业,均未幸免.
1900/1/1 0:00:00稳定币是旨在维持稳定价格的数字代币,通常由储备资产支持或通过算法进行控制。这些储备资产可以采用加密货币或法定货币.
1900/1/1 0:00:00